5220579 The Guildhall, Exeter (engraving) by Baynes, Thomas Mann (1794-1854) (after); Private Collection; (add.info.: The Guildhall, Exeter. To the Right Worshipful the Mayor, Recorder, Aldermen and Common Council of the City of Exeter, this Plate is most respectfully inscribed by the Proprietors. Illustration for The History of Devonshire by Thomas Moore illustrated by a series of views drawn and engraved under the direction of William Deeble (Robert Jennings, 1829).); © Look and Learn

The Guildhall, Exeter: A Glimpse into the Historical Tapestry of Devonshire This print captures an exquisite engraving of The Guildhall in Exeter, a testament to the rich history and architectural grandeur that graces this charming city. Created by Thomas Mann Baynes (1794-1854) and preserved within a private collection, this engraving is a true treasure. The intricate details showcased in this nineteenth-century view transport us back in time, offering a glimpse into the bustling life of Exeter during that era. It was originally inscribed as a tribute to the Right Worshipful Mayor, Recorder, Aldermen, and Common Council of the City of Exeter by its proprietors. Commissioned for "The History of Devonshire" written by Thomas Moore and illustrated under William Deeble's direction in 1829, this plate serves as an invaluable historical document. Its inclusion within Moore's work allows us to explore Devon's past through a series of meticulously drawn views.
